1. Fiber Sort

Fiber sort considerably influences cloth price. Pure fibers usually fall into two classes: plant-based (reminiscent of cotton, linen, and hemp) and animal-based (reminiscent of silk, wool, and cashmere). Artificial fibers, like polyester, nylon, and acrylic, are derived from petroleum-based chemical compounds. The inherent properties of every fiber, together with the agricultural or manufacturing processes concerned, contribute to price variations. For instance, cultivating silk requires specialised labor and complicated processes, leading to the next value level in comparison with available cotton.

The price variations lengthen past uncooked materials manufacturing. Processing, spinning, and dyeing every fiber sort require particular methods and tools. Silk, for instance, calls for delicate dealing with all through manufacturing, additional including to its price. Conversely, artificial fibers typically profit from streamlined, automated processes, contributing to decrease manufacturing prices. These variations in the end affect the ultimate value per yard, impacting decisions for numerous functions. A cotton t-shirt, as an example, displays the affordability of cotton, whereas an opulent silk scarf displays the upper price of silk manufacturing.

2. Material Development

Material development considerably influences the ultimate price per yard. Understanding the varied development strategies and their influence on pricing permits for knowledgeable materials choice and finances administration. From easy plain weaves to intricate jacquard patterns, the complexity of the development course of straight correlates with the general price.

  • Weaving

    Weaving includes interlacing two units of yarns, warp and weft, at proper angles. Easy weaves, reminiscent of plain weave (used for calico and muslin) and twill weave (used for denim and chino), are comparatively cost-effective because of their easy development. Extra advanced weaves, like satin and jacquard, require specialised looms and complicated patterns, growing manufacturing time and value. Jacquard looms, able to producing intricate designs like brocade and damask, contribute considerably to the upper value level of those materials.

  • Knitting

    Knitting creates cloth by interlocking loops of yarn. The price of knitted materials varies relying on the complexity of the knit construction. Fundamental jersey knit, used for t-shirts, is comparatively cheap to supply. Extra advanced knits, like cable knit or rib knit, require extra intricate equipment and longer manufacturing occasions, leading to greater prices. The kind of yarn used additionally impacts the fee, with finer yarns like merino wool sometimes costing greater than acrylic or cotton blends.

  • Non-Woven Materials

    Non-woven materials, reminiscent of felt and interfacing, are manufactured by bonding or interlocking fibers mechanically, thermally, or chemically. These materials typically bypass conventional yarn spinning and weaving processes. Manufacturing prices differ relying on the particular bonding technique and the fibers used. Whereas some non-woven materials supply economical options for particular functions like insulation or interlining, others, reminiscent of high-performance non-wovens utilized in medical textiles, might be fairly costly.

  • Ending Processes

    Ending processes, reminiscent of dyeing, printing, and particular therapies, additional influence cloth price. Dyeing can vary from easy strong colours to advanced gradient or resist dyeing methods. Printing strategies, together with display screen printing and digital printing, additionally differ in price relying on the intricacy of the design and the amount produced. Further therapies, reminiscent of waterproofing, wrinkle resistance, or flame retardancy, add additional complexity and value to the ultimate product.

3. Manufacturing Origin

Manufacturing origin considerably influences cloth prices. A number of interconnected components contribute to those value variations. Labor prices signify a major driver. Areas with decrease labor prices, reminiscent of Southeast Asia, typically produce textiles at decrease costs in comparison with areas with greater labor requirements and wages, like Western Europe or North America. This distinction displays within the ultimate value per yard for shoppers.

Past labor, infrastructure performs a vital function. Areas with well-developed textile manufacturing infrastructure, together with environment friendly transportation networks and available uncooked supplies, can supply decrease manufacturing prices. Conversely, areas missing such infrastructure might expertise greater transportation bills and uncooked materials sourcing challenges, impacting the ultimate cloth value. As an example, materials produced in areas with established textile industries, like India or China, might profit from economies of scale and established provide chains, resulting in decrease prices in comparison with materials produced in areas with nascent textile industries.

Authorities laws and commerce agreements additionally affect cloth pricing. Tariffs, import quotas, and commerce agreements can both enhance or lower the price of importing and exporting materials, impacting the ultimate value for shoppers. Materials sourced from nations with preferential commerce agreements could also be extra competitively priced than these topic to tariffs or commerce restrictions. Moreover, environmental laws and sustainability initiatives can influence manufacturing prices. Corporations adhering to stringent environmental requirements might incur greater manufacturing bills, which may replicate within the ultimate value of their materials. 6. Retail Markup

Retail markup considerably influences the ultimate price shoppers pay for material. This markup represents the distinction between the wholesale value a retailer pays for the material and the retail value charged to the patron. It covers the retailer’s working bills, together with lease, utilities, workers salaries, advertising and marketing, and revenue margins. Understanding retail markup supplies insights into pricing constructions and empowers shoppers to make knowledgeable buying choices.

A number of components affect retail markup. Location performs a key function. Retailers in prime places with excessive foot visitors and lease typically incorporate greater markups to offset working prices. Equally, retailers providing specialised providers, reminiscent of customized slicing, design session, or stitching courses, might incorporate greater markups to replicate the added worth offered. On-line retailers, whereas probably benefiting from decrease overhead prices, should incorporate markups to cowl web site upkeep, on-line advertising and marketing, and achievement bills. Competitors additionally influences markup. In extremely aggressive markets, retailers might regulate markups to stay aggressive, probably providing decrease costs. Conversely, retailers providing unique or specialised materials might keep greater markups because of restricted competitors.
